MAS³: A Geometric Cognitive Architecture for Multi-Agent AI Systems - A Conceptual Three-Dimensional Framework
Description
This paper introduces MAS³ (Multi-Agent System Cubed), a conceptual three-dimensional framework for organizing multi-agent AI systems along orthogonal axes of Role, Domain, and Layer. The architecture defines a 3×3×3 grid of micro-agents supporting modular specialization and structured cross-dimensional verification.
This is a purely conceptual framework with no implementation, performance claims, or new mathematical results. Fibonacci numbers are presented as a design heuristic for bounding recursive hierarchies, and tensor representations are discussed as a modeling lens.
This version (v1-Revised) supersedes an earlier draft and represents the foundational MAS³ contribution before extensions to N-dimensional frameworks (see companion MASⁿ paper).
